How to Choose a Cost-effective Strapping Machine?
Choosing a cost-effective strapping machine can significantly enhance productivity and reduce expenses in your packaging operations. Various industry experts share valuable insights on how to approach this decision, ensuring that you invest wisely and meet your specific needs. One crucial aspect to consider is the machine's efficiency. Emily Carter, a packaging consultant with over ten years of experience, emphasizes, "Look for machines that offer speed and reliability without sacrificing quality." She suggests assessing the strapping speed, as machines that can operate faster will save labor costs in the long run. Additionally, durability and maintenance are vital factors. Mark Thompson, who has supplied strapping machines for a decade, notes that "Choosing a robust machine that requires minimal maintenance can significantly lower your long-term operational costs." He recommends researching machine materials and construction quality to ensure they withstand regular use. Another expert, Sarah Nguyen, a production manager, advises potential buyers to consider the versatility of the machine. "Opt for a strapping machine that can handle various strapping materials and sizes. This flexibility can be a game-changer when adapting to different products," she explains. Cost is, of course, a primary concern. When comparing prices, many users overlook the total cost of ownership. Joshua Lee, an industrial engineer, highlights, "It's essential to factor in maintenance costs and potential downtimes when evaluating the prices of strapping machines.
